CVE-2023-29051

User-defined OXMF templates could be used to access a limited part of the internal OX App Suite Java API. The existing switch to disable the feature by default was not effective in this case. Unauthorized users could discover and modify application state, including objects related to other users and contexts. We now make sure that the switch to disable user-generated templates by default works as intended and will remove the feature in future generations of the product. No publicly available exploits are known.

CVE-2023-29050

The optional "LDAP contacts provider" could be abused by privileged users to inject LDAP filter strings that allow to access content outside of the intended hierarchy. Unauthorized users could break confidentiality of information in the directory and potentially cause high load on the directory server, leading to denial of service. Encoding has been added for user-provided fragments that are used when constructing the LDAP query. No publicly available exploits are known.

CVE-2023-29048

A component for parsing OXMF templates could be abused to execute arbitrary system commands that would be executed as the non-privileged runtime user. Users and attackers could run system commands with limited privilege to gain unauthorized access to confidential information and potentially violate integrity by modifying resources. The template engine has been reconfigured to deny execution of harmful commands on a system level. No publicly available exploits are known.
